Knowledge regarding prevention of worm infestations among mothers of under five children

Abstract
Background: World Health Organization reported that worm infestation is one of the common health problems worldwide especially among children. WHO estimated that about 1400 million people worldwide are infected with at least one type of Intestinal worm. Hook worm, Pin worm and, Tape worm commonly acquired orally or parentally or both routs. Objectives: 1. To assess the knowledge regarding prevention of worm infestations among mothers of under five children. 2. To find out the association between the level of knowledge regarding prevention of worm infestation with selected socio demographic variables. Materials and Methods: The Non-experimental descriptive design with non probability Convenience sampling technique was adapted to select 60 mothers of under five children in Venkatachalam at Nellore District. Results: The result shows that among 60 samples 60(98.4%) of mothers have inadequate knowledge and 1(1.6%) of mothers have adequate knowledge regarding prevention of worm infestation.
